26. Ebenezer BASFORD (Jacob3, James2, Jacob1). Born on 9 Nov 1744 in Chester, NH. [165], [229] Ebenezer died in Chester, NH, on 21 Sep 1816. [235], [236] age 74. Buried in Chester Village Cemetery, Chester, NH. [236]

He is mentioned in the settlement of his father’s estate. [144]

Served in the Canada Expedition of 1760. He went with his father, Jacob, as surveyor and piloted the troops to Ticonderoga. [237], [2]

He also served in the Revolutionary War as a private in John Webster’s regiment under Lt. John Lane. [2]

He joined the Congregational Church in Chester, NH 26 May 1782. [237]
